Nickel white gold also can cause a metallurgical problem known as stress corrosion cracking.
Stress corrosion cracking is caused by weak grain boundaries that occur in wrought product that is hard and under stress.
This is usually seen as broken or cracked prongs on rings.
Nickel white golds are also poor in their ability to be reused.
This causes a high amount of scrap, which needs to be refined and recycled with the associated costs.

Abstract

A nickel- and palladium-free 14-karat white gold alloy composition consists essentially of the following parts by weight: about 58.34% gold, about 35-40% silver, about 0.5-1.80% tin, and about 0-0.75% germanium.

Description

TECHNICAL FIELD [0001] This invention relates to novel white gold alloy compositions that exhibit the desirable properties of improved color and workability, but without the use of nickel, palladium or platinum. BACKGROUND ART [0002] Many white gold alloy compositions are known. Most are used in making jewelry. There is no standard or specification for the composition of white gold. Many white golds alloys contain nickel or palladium as the bleaching agent. Silver, the whitest of all elements, can be used as the bleaching agent. However, in alloys above 9 karat (i.e., 37.5% gold), silver causes the alloy color to become greenish. Green gold typically includes gold, a high amount of silver, and a small amount of copper. [0003] When nickel is used as the main bleaching agent, the amount of nickel determines the whiteness of the gold. The main advantage of nickel is low cost.
